The best possible timing for pruning will differ depending on the type of tree and where you live. Generally, it's ideal to have a tree pruner cut back your trees throughout the dormant time of year.
Wintertime is a great time for tree upkeep due to the fact that the remainder of your yard should not require any type of attention during that time. Thinning trees preceding the springtime sprouting and growing period will certainly enable your trees to shoot out and flourish well.
There is normally not a problem doing tree upkeep during the springtime and summertime as well, especially if there is any kind of dead wood, disease, or overgrowth.
Palm trees require a great deal of care during pruning. Cutting the limbs at the wrong time can leave them defenseless against infections. Palm trees must be pruned when the older growth has actually turned brown and died. This is usually one or two times in a year.
Staying on top of regular maintenance is important for preventing damages and injuries from tough and massive dropping palm branches.
The best time to cut back your pine trees is during the very first part of spring, however if at any time you find dying or infected branches, it's a good strategy to deal with those.
Using proper pruning techniques is truly vital. Hacking back branches to shorten them, is honestly a bad idea since it might stop the branch from growing entirely. That might leave the branch stunted and off balance permanently.
In the springtime when the pine tree starts to sprout out, crimping back the fresh growth tips can provide a compact and dense growth that is particularly appealing.
